Eaton Vance Tax-Advantage Global Dividend Opp (ETO) is a closed-end fund focused on delivering tax-advantaged global dividend income to investors. As of 2026-04-15, ETO is trading at a current price of $29.0, marking a 0.92% decline on the day. This analysis covers key technical levels for the fund, recent market context for dividend-focused investment products, and potential near-term price scenarios for market participants to monitor. Technical Analysis

From a technical perspective, ETO is currently trading in a well-defined range that has held for most of recent weeks, with clear support and resistance levels identified by market analysts. The first key support level to watch sits at $27.55, a price point that has coincided with increased buying interest on prior pullbacks in the past month. If ETO continues to trade lower in upcoming sessions, this level may act as a near-term floor for price action, as buyers have historically stepped in to limit declines near this threshold. On the upside, the key resistance level is at $30.45, a level that has capped multiple upward attempts in recent weeks, as sellers have stepped in to limit gains each time the fund has approached this price point. Momentum indicators for ETO are currently showing neutral near-term trends: the relative strength index (RSI) is in the mid-40s, indicating no extreme overbought or oversold conditions at current price levels. ETO is also trading between its short-term and medium-term simple moving averages, further confirming the lack of a clear one-sided near-term trend for the fund. Outlook

For the upcoming weeks, there are two key scenarios market participants may watch for ETO. First, a sustained break above the $30.45 resistance level, if accompanied by higher-than-average trading volume, could signal a potential shift in near-term momentum, possibly leading to an expansion of the fund’s trading range to the upside. A confirmed breakout would likely draw additional attention from momentum-focused investors monitoring the closed-end fund space. Conversely, a sustained break below the $27.55 support level on elevated volume might indicate rising selling pressure, potentially leading to further near-term downside price action. Broader macro trends, including shifts in interest rate expectations, global dividend equity performance, and changes in demand for tax-advantaged income products, will likely be key drivers of ETO’s price trajectory in the near term. Investors monitoring the fund may also pay close attention to any upcoming announcements related to its dividend distribution policy, which could impact investor sentiment toward ETO in upcoming months.
